Online Class Availability at Chaffey College
Distance learning is available at Chaffey College. Among 22,460 students, 11,911 (53%) studied exclusively online and 7,024 (31%) took at least some classes online.

Best-Paid Careers for Real Estate Graduates
Students who finish Real Estate program at Chaffey College go on to a range of careers. The table below ranks the highest-paying careers for Real Estate graduates, ordered by median annual salary:
| Occupation | Nationwide Median Wage |
|---|---|
| Appraisers of Personal and Business Property | $118,242 |
| Property, Real Estate, and Community Association Managers | $77,609 |
| Appraisers and Assessors of Real Estate | $61,167 |
| Real Estate Sales Agents | $44,773 |
| Real Estate Brokers | $36,148 |
